Natural disasters can cause significant economic and social damage without proper warning systems. Weather monitoring equipment helps authorities detect environmental changes before they become dangerous situations. By tracking atmospheric conditions, these technologies provide early warnings that allow communities to prepare and reduce potential losses.

Modern weather monitoring solutions include automated weather stations, radar systems, satellite-based monitoring tools, and advanced sensors. These technologies collect real-time information from different locations and transmit data to analysis platforms. Emergency management agencies use this information to evaluate risks and coordinate response activities during severe weather events.

Flood monitoring is one of the most important applications of weather technology. Heavy rainfall and changing climate conditions have increased flood risks in many regions. Rain gauges, water-level sensors, and forecasting models help authorities monitor rainfall intensity and predict possible flooding. This information supports evacuation planning and infrastructure protection.

Storm prediction also depends heavily on advanced weather monitoring systems. Wind speed sensors, pressure monitoring devices, and radar technologies help identify developing storm conditions. Accurate forecasting allows aviation, marine, and public safety organizations to take preventive measures before severe storms occur.

Climate change research has increased the importance of long-term weather data collection. Scientists analyze historical and current environmental information to understand climate trends. Weather monitoring networks provide essential data for studying temperature changes, rainfall variations, and atmospheric conditions. This knowledge supports climate adaptation strategies and environmental policies.

The integration of digital technologies has transformed disaster monitoring. Cloud computing enables large-scale storage and processing of environmental data. Artificial intelligence systems analyze information quickly and identify potential risks. Mobile applications and communication platforms allow weather alerts to reach people instantly.

Agriculture also benefits from disaster-focused weather monitoring. Farmers use forecasting information to protect crops from extreme weather conditions. Early warnings about storms, droughts, or excessive rainfall allow agricultural communities to make better decisions and minimize losses.

The development of low-cost sensors is expanding access to weather monitoring technology. Smaller organizations, educational institutions, and local communities can now deploy affordable monitoring solutions. This wider adoption improves data availability and strengthens regional forecasting networks.

Challenges remain, including equipment maintenance, data management, and infrastructure limitations in remote areas. However, continued innovation is helping overcome these barriers. Future systems are expected to become more automated, accurate, and accessible.
